Statistics show that the average cost of a full sleeve tattoo in the UK ranges from £1,000 to £5,000. This does not take into account any costs for touch-ups, aftercare products, or potential additions to the tattoo down the line.

But why such a high cost for a full sleeve tattoo? Tattoo artists typically charge by the hour or by the session, with sessions lasting anywhere from four to six hours. This can add up quickly, especially if the design has intricate details or requires multiple sessions to complete.

The Price Of Beauty

The cost of a full sleeve tattoo varies depending on various factors such as the experience level of the tattoo artist, location, complexity of the design and size of the tattoo among others. According to research, the average cost of a full sleeve tattoo in the UK ranges between £1,000 and £4,000. However, this could go up to £10,000 for more intricate designs by renowned tattoo artists.

What is the average cost of a full sleeve tattoo in the UK?

The average cost of a full sleeve tattoo in the UK ranges from £1,000 to £4,000.

How long does it take to get a full sleeve tattoo?

The time it takes to get a full sleeve tattoo varies depending on the complexity and size of the design. It can take anywhere from 20 hours to 80 hours or more.

Do all tattoo artists charge the same for a full sleeve tattoo?

No, the cost of a full sleeve tattoo can vary depending on the artist's experience, location, and reputation.

Are there any additional costs associated with getting a full sleeve tattoo?

Yes, there may be additional costs for consultations, touch-ups, or aftercare products.

How do I find a reputable tattoo artist in the UK?

You can research tattoo artists online or ask for recommendations from friends who have gotten tattoos. Look for artists who have a portfolio of their work and positive reviews from previous clients.
